Adopt working practices by Senior Client Services Manager Work in accordance to the agreed business process Ensure KPI measures for Service Excellence are delivered upon. Sales & Customer relationships and play an active role in the on-going client relationship. Direct client contact. Provide proposals for continuous improvement. Feedback on initiatives for individual customer accounts to add value and drive increased profitability. Report on positive activity driven by the Group. Report lack of compliance to business process Escalate issues and offer up solutions to problems. Ensure client service KPI (key performance indicators) are delivered upon. Responsible for project purchase order cover for own projects Work with senior peers to understand how you manage client briefs and interpret these for Augustus Martin Group (Design / CAD / Print / Data brief for dynamic print / Logistics / AFD). Raise concerns where required to Senior Client Services Manager. Communicate critical paths to clients and internal teams to manage expectations. Review and fill in gaps in client briefs.

For over 50 years Augustus Martin have been a market leader in the manufacture of POS and Out-Of-Home communication. Over that time, in the ever-changing world of brand and retail marketing solutions, the only thing that has stayed constant is the innovation and craftsmanship of our team members. Our award-winning products and services and our continual drive for perfection, has enabled us to become the trusted partner for the biggest retailers and brands. We are proud of our manufacturing heritage which is underpinned by a deeply engrained service ethos and the desire to always go the extra mile for our clients. These values are the foundation of our success. Never frightened of change, our business has constantly evolved to offer sustainable end-to-end solutions in POS and Out-Of-Home environments. Our services and technical solutions ensure we can cost effectively deliver at every point from concept to installation.
